> the kleopatra documentation says:
>
> "Since validating a key may take some time (e.g. CRLs might need to be
> fetched), the normal keylisting does not attempt to check the validity of
> keys. For this,  Certificates->Validate (Shift+F5), a special variant of
> View->Redisplay (F5), is provided. It either checks the selected
> certificates, or all keys if none are selected."
>
> But in kleopatra >=4.0 there is no menu action Certificates->Validate
> anymore.
>
> Was this funtionality completely removed or is it naow in another menu
> action?

Kleopatra now always does a validating keylisting, thus there is no need for 
triggering it manually anymore. When the documentation was written, the 
automatic keylisting did not validate by default, thus the action.
